Added togglegaps

pull/13/head
E. Almqvist 4 years ago
parent 50952da422
commit ff9e3c1b77
  1. 2
      src/config.h
  2. 7
      src/dwm.c

@ -115,7 +115,7 @@ static Key keys[] = {
{ MODKEY|ShiftMask, XK_x, spawn, {.v = betterlockscreencmd} }, { MODKEY|ShiftMask, XK_x, spawn, {.v = betterlockscreencmd} },
{ MODKEY, XK_Print, spawn, {.v = spectaclecmd} }, { MODKEY, XK_Print, spawn, {.v = spectaclecmd} },
{ MODKEY, XK_u, spawn, {.v = cmuspausecmd} }, { MODKEY, XK_u, spawn, {.v = cmuspausecmd} },
{ MODKEY, XK_g, setgaps, {.v = cmuspausecmd}}, { MODKEY, XK_g, togglegaps, {0} },
TAGKEYS( XK_1, 0) TAGKEYS( XK_1, 0)
TAGKEYS( XK_2, 1) TAGKEYS( XK_2, 1)
TAGKEYS( XK_3, 2) TAGKEYS( XK_3, 2)

@ -1691,7 +1691,12 @@ setgaps(const Arg *arg)
void void
togglegaps(const Arg *arg) togglegaps(const Arg *arg)
{ {
if(selmon->gappx == 0) {
selmon->gappx = gappx;
} else {
selmon->gappx = 0;
}
arrange(selmon);
} }
void void

Loading…
Cancel
Save